[W1800 P7].
Short title: Pond v Pond.
Document type: two bills and two answers.
Plaintiffs: John Pond and others.
Defendants: John Paul Smith, John I'Anson (amended to Margaret I'Anson), Mary King, William Kimber, John Kimber, Susannah Everett, Elizabeth Goodyer, Thomas Adams, Elizabeth Adams, Thomas Adams (junior), Charles Adams, George Adams, John Adams, Hannah Adams, Harriet Adams, [unknown] Adams, [unknown] Adams, Daniel Wright, Phineas Wright, Richard Pond (amended to John Pond), John Riddick and wife, Jane Gardner, James Richardson and John Wright (amended to Joseph Wright).
Amended by an order dated 28 February 1800: Henry Harper, Samuel Fyler, Thomas King, John King, William King, Elizabeth King, Hannah King, Mary King (junior), Rachel King and William Payne and wife added as defendants:[unknown] Adams, [unknown] Adams, Phineas Wright and James Richardson removed as defendants.
